> No!
>
> Back the right odds!
>
> Counting from the white line at the centre to the left it's 2, 4 ,6 etc
> to 32 and to the right 1,3,5 etc to 31.

> Andy Greening wrote:
>> At the back of the switch you will find a connector (a set of what look 
>> like
>> teeth for want of a better description!) This is called the 'u' points.
>>
>> There is a white line between the middle ones. If you count from that 
>> line
>> outwards to the right (this is the even connectors (I Think!!!)) they go 
>> 2,
>> 4, 6, 8,10 etc.  contact 12 is Battery (ie -50 v dc) Note that each 'pin' 
>> is
>> two contacts, there is a small insulating piece between them, so contact 
>> 12
>> is the outer contact on the third pin.
>>
>> Counting the other way from the line you go 1, 3, 5, 7, etc and contact 
>> 11
>> is earth (ie 0 v dc).
>>
>> Incoming line is on 1 and 2, p wire is on 9. So looping 1 and 2 out to a
>> loop dialling jellybone will allow you to dial into it.

>> With many many thanks to Jon for pointing me in the right direction, I
>> have obtained the maintenance documentation for a switch *very* similar
>> to mine. There are only a few differences, making me think it's a
>> slightly different model, but there was more than enough information to
>> get the switch fixed and adjusted into a workable condition. It now
>> steps horizontally and vertically with no trouble at all, and returns
>> to the home position flawlessly.
>>
>>
>>
>> The only thing now is to make sure the electrical side of things work
>> properly. As I don't have a 48.6V supply at the moment, I can't do any
>> testing as yet... Not that I could without knowing where the power needs 
>> to
>> go. Tracing the wires is out of the question, as any color the wires may
>> have had has since faded into obscurity. Still looking for a schematic of
>> the switch, or at least a pinout so I know what connections on the back 
>> and
>> front are used for what.
>>
>> There are 2 wire jumpers on the front test panel, a red and green one. I
>> don't know what these are for - perhaps used to take the switch out of
>> service?
